Rating:  Summary: Something cooking? Review: Blue blood Grace North had always dreamed of wrong-side of the tracks Kyle McRaney. As a 17 year old she thought Kyle was going to elope with her. Intead Kyle left town with Libby to forge a new live in Chicago. Now 7 years later Kyle is back, a widower with a 3 year-old and a special talent for cooking. For the next 3 months Kyle is Grace's personal chef, a gift from Kyle friend and Grace's brother, Michael. Kyle and Michael are working to reopen an old resturant. As you can imagine Kyle and Grace dance around their attraction to each other. Old feelings, haunts, and events surround their story. As the store unfolds these situations and feelings are brought forth and shown how they relate to the people today. In the end Kyle and Grace realize their feelings for each other. Kyle recognizes the woman Grace has become and Grace sees beyond her teenage crush to the man Kyle is now. While overall the story was a good one I never got the feeling Kyle and Grace connected. Some stories you can feel the connection and that was missing in this story.
